Gather easy-to-getandevolve Pokemon, like Pidgey. Pidgey is simple to come by and just cost 12 Pidgey Candy to evolve. The more, the better. Save them for a Lucky Egg evolution binge. Favored all the Pokemon you want to evolve with a star to keep matters in order.
To get a throw incentive, the thrown Poke Ball must land in of the coloured circle. So, for example, if you catch a brand new Pokemon with a totally thrown Poke Ball, you'll get 700 XP for it!
This is also an excellent time to have one or two egg incubators close to hatching, as you'll also get a fit of XP. To reap the gains, you could catch a lot of common Pokemon, like Pidgey or Caterpie, which require comparatively few Candy to evolve. New Pokemon will also give a bonus, so joining tons of common Pokemon to evolve with a number of Pokemon that evolves into something new can make a great combo.

Training at favorable Gyms and challenging competing Gyms earns you XP, but it changes. The closer your Pokemon's CP is to your competitor's and the more Pokemon you conquer, the more XP you will earn. If you desire to maximize the XP you gain from combating, use a Pokemon with a CP score that matches, or are less than, the adversaries. Alternatively, locate a friendly gym with some Pokemon you can easily conquer, and repeatedly train - or even insert one of your lower level Pokemon that another in your team can easily defeat.

Most eggs take between two to five kilometers to hatch, but just like in the original Pokemon games, the more it takes to hatch the rarer the Pokemon probably is!
Your Trainer's level affects quite a couple of features in the game. The higher your Trainer amount, the more powerful and rarer the Pokemon you are going to encounter and the higher you can raise your Pokemon's CP. Considering this, it's best to increase your Trainer level as economically as possible so you can compete with competing team's Gyms and catch new, rarer Pokemon! To do this, you should get XP.
If you desire to save on battery power, make sure you enable the Battery Saver in the Settings, and put the phone upside down in your hand or pocket - which will darken the display and disable most functions aside from monitoring your motion, and alarming you to Pokemon or PokeStops.
With a Lucky Egg activated, each developed Pokemon will allow you 1,000 XP! If you're developing a Pokemon into one you haven't caught before, you'll get 2,000 XP! Catching a Pokemon is only going to internet you 200 XP, but if you catch a brand new Pokemon, you'll get 1,200 XP.
The first item to consider when needing to level is the Lucky Egg. When activated, this item will double all XP earned for thirty minutes! Combine this with Incense or a Tempt Module and you'll be raking in XP just by catching lots of Pokemon. Be sure you've stocked up on Poke Balls before doing this, either at PokeStops or the Store! Plan to evolve bunches of Pokemon and investigate new areas saturated with PokeStops before activating a Lucky Egg to ensure you'll take advantage of it!
